Two kids. One Apollo, the other, Sarah. Both living in a dystopian future full of people with “modifications”. Everyone has them, well, most everyone has them. Then there’s people like Apollo, Sarah, and Zeke. Until Zeke decided randomly to join almost everyone else. Their world is constantly changing with new surprises around every corner. With their society on the brink of destruction, Sarah and Apollo have to face this new reality, with many twists
